How Floris Neighborhoods Flood
Every neighborhood in Floris has a different water damage risk profile. The one that shows up on most restoration calls is Floris, Iowa is prone to flooding due to its location in a rural area with low-lying terrain and proximity to the Raccoon River. Heavy rainfall events and snowmelt can quickly lead to water accumulation, especially in the surrounding agricultural fields and residential areas. The community's drainage systems are often overwhelmed during severe weather, causing localized flooding..
Floris experiences a humid continental climate with significant precipitation throughout the year. Spring and early summer bring the highest risk of flooding due to increased rainfall and snowmelt. The area is also susceptible to flash flooding during thunderstorms, which can cause rapid water buildup in low-lying regions.
